Regular flushing of one’s water heater is considered the single most important step you consider to prolong its service life this particular save energy. A duration of time, sediments amass in the bottom of your hot water heater. These sediments act as a barrier between the flame and the tank, thereby making your heater burn longer and hotter. This is not just destructive to the tank, but highly inefficient and will significantly raise your heating costs.

In most regions of the country, the common water heater lasts 3-5 years. Regularly flushing your water heater can double the life of your hot water heater from 3-5 to 7-10 years. Something else costs of replacement running from $700 to over $1200 in some cases, getting the most from your heater ‘s very important in today’s markets. In addition, regular flushing makes your water heater run more efficiently and can cut heating costs fifty percent. Depending on the volume of hot water your home uses, that can mean a savings of $20 to over $50 a fair amount of time.

To drain your water heater, you can find should set the thermostat to pilot (if it is really a gas water heater) or turn the circuit breaker off (if it is electric heater). Failure to do so could result in overheating and severe damage to the actual heater. Next, close the water supply valve located more than a water inlet line going into your water heater. Then you’re connect a hose to the drain valve located at the base of the hot water heater. Open the drain and allow it to function until all of the water has emptied from the heating unit. Then close the drain. Open the water supply valve and refill the heater tank. You should also open a hot water faucet somewhere at home and stand there and watch it run for several minutes until the flows out quietly. This will allow air to vent via the heater and the hot water lines. Finally, you can turn the thermostat in order to its regular setting (for a gas heater), or turn the circuit breakers back on (for an electric heater).

Besides regularly flushing your water heater, plumbing experts also advise adding a water treatment system to your property to filter or condition the water so may less corrosive to your plumbing system, particularly in areas possess hard water.
